Blancpain Act 3 – Fifty Fathoms 70th Anniversary

Following the Fifty Fathoms 70% Anniversary Act 1 and Act 2 Tech Gombessa, Blancpain continues to celebrate the 70 years of the iconic diver’s watch by unveiling the Fifty Fathoms 70th Anniversary Act 3, a 555-piece limited-edition that reinterprets the MIL-SPEC model adopted by the main armed forces of the 1950s.

The MIL-SPEC watch introduced a moisture indicator in 1957. This indicator served as an additional safety feature. Its purpose was to confirm that the watch remained undamaged from previous missions, reassuring divers. This moisture indicator was a crucial part of the specifications set by the US Navy, which considered this model the only one meeting all the rigorous criteria for their underwater missions.
The Fifty Fathoms 70th Anniversary Act 3 pays tribute to that watch.
This third anniversary timepiece comes in a 41.30 mm (the same diameter as the original MIL-SPEC) x 13.30 mm case crafted from 9K Bronze Gold, a patented alloy enriched with 37.5% gold (hallmarked 9K), copper – 50%, allowing it to be called “bronze” – silver, palladium and gallium.
Designed to offer a pink hue and pleasing aesthetics, this type of bronze stands out because it can be worn in direct contact with the skin. Additionally, it has a longer lifespan, as the typical bronze oxidation to a verdigris color is prevented by the addition of gold. Water resistance is guaranteed up to a pressure of 30 bar (300 metres / 1,000 feet).
The unidirectional rotating bezel features a black ceramic insert with a vintage Super-LumiNova diving scale.
A raised sapphire crystal protects the matt black dial with vintage Super-LumiNova-enhanced hands and hour-markers. At 6 o’clock we find the water-tightness indicator.
The Fifty Fathoms 70th Anniversary Act 3 is powered by the 1154.P2 Calibre, beating at a frequency of 3 Hz (21,600 vibrations per hour) and offering a remarkable power reserve of 100 hours.
Unlike the original version of this calibre – whose movement is not visible because resistance to magnetic fields was only possible at the time by encasing the mechanism in a soft iron cage – the heart of the Fifty Fathoms 70th Anniversary Act 3 can be admired through a sapphire crystal caseback, as the use of a non-magnetic silicon balance-spring enables the timepiece to feature such transparency without compromising its resistance to magnetism.
The oscillating weight features a design inspired by the historical rotor. It has an opening to enhance flexibility and shock resistance. Its snail-shaped finish echoes its rotational movement. The engraved vintage logo in 18K gold adds the final vintage touch to the watch’s appearance.
The watch is paired with a two-tone NATO strap featuring the colour code of the original timepiece and made from fishing nets recovered from the oceans.
Issued in a 555-piece limited edition, the Fifty Fathoms 70th Anniversary Act 3 ref. 5901-5630-NANA is presented in a box inspired by a historic camera housing, echoing Blancpain’s ocean protection initiatives. Its retail price is CHF 30,000.
